Manual Handling Legislation and Regulations
Manual handling activities are governed by specific legislation, such as the Manual Handling Operations Regulations 1992, which require employers to assess and reduce risks. These laws mandate employers to provide suitable training, ensuring employees can perform tasks safely. Additionally, regulations like the Provision and Use of Work Equipment Regulations (PUWER) and the Health and Safety at Work etc. Act 1974 emphasize the importance of a safe working environment. Non-compliance with these regulations can lead to legal consequences, including fines and liability for workplace injuries. Understanding and adhering to these laws is crucial for employers to maintain compliance and safeguard their workforce effectively.

Understanding Posture and Movement in Manual Handling
Proper posture and movement are fundamental to safe manual handling. Trainers should teach how to maintain a neutral spine position during lifting to minimize strain on the back. Emphasizing balanced movements, such as bending at the knees and keeping loads close to the body, reduces injury risk. Demonstrating techniques like squatting or stooping appropriately can help participants adopt safer practices. Highlighting common postural mistakes, such as twisting or reaching, is crucial. By focusing on efficient body mechanics, trainers can help workers perform tasks with greater safety and effectiveness, reducing the likelihood of musculoskeletal injuries in the workplace.

Identifying Manual Handling Hazards in the Workplace
Identifying manual handling hazards is crucial for preventing injuries. Assess tasks for factors like heavy loads, awkward postures, or repetitive movements. Environmental factors such as uneven surfaces or limited space can also contribute. Personal factors, including individual capabilities and pre-existing conditions, should be considered. Observations, risk assessments, and employee feedback are key tools for identifying hazards. Trainers should emphasize task-specific risks and encourage proactive approaches to hazard recognition. By systematically evaluating these elements, workplaces can reduce injury risks and create safer environments for manual handling tasks. This step is foundational for implementing effective control measures and ensuring compliance with safety standards.
Implementing Control Measures to Reduce Injury Risk
Effective control measures are essential to minimize manual handling risks. Start by introducing mechanical aids, such as hoists or trolleys, to reduce physical strain. Redesign tasks to eliminate unnecessary lifting or repetitive actions. Provide personal protective equipment (PPE) where required. Ensure proper workplace layout to avoid awkward postures. Train employees in correct lifting techniques and encourage regular breaks. Monitor work practices to maintain compliance with safety standards. Regularly review and update control measures based on feedback and changing work conditions. These steps create a safer environment, reduce injury risks, and promote long-term employee well-being.
- Mechanical aids for load reduction.
- Task redesign to eliminate unsafe practices.
- Proper use of PPE.
- Regular monitoring and feedback.
By implementing these measures, workplaces can significantly reduce manual handling injuries and improve overall safety.
